Brief summary
The aim of this study is to examine the effects of ISIS 113715 monotherapy on insulin sensitivity, glucose and lipid metabolism and energy expenditure in subjects with type 2 diabetes mellitus.

Eligibility
Inclusion criteria
* Male or female (post menopausal and/or surgically sterile) * Aged 18 to 70 years * Treatment naïve subjects with fasting blood glucose levels of 150-220 mg/dL, hematocrit of \>/= 35% and HbA1c levels of \>/= 7% and \</= 10.0% * Subjects on antidiabetic therapy with fasting blood glucose levels of 100-200 mg/dL, hematocrit of \>/= 35%, and HbA1c levels of \>/= 6.5% and \</= 9.0%
Exclusion criteria
* Greater than 3 severe hypoglycemic episodes within six months of screen * Pregnant, breastfeeding, or intends to become pregnant * Clinical signs or symptoms of liver disease, acute or chronic hepatitis, or ALT greater than 1.5 times the upper limit of normal * History of hepatitis B surface antigen, hepatitis C antibody, or HIV * Complications of diabetes (e.g., neuropathy, nephropathy, and retinopathy) * Clinically significant and currently active diseases * Clinically significant abnormalities in medical history, physical examination, or laboratory examination
Design outcomes
Primary
| Measure | Time frame |
|---|---|
| Evaluate the effects of ISIS 113715 on hepatic and peripheral insulin sensitivity | — |
| Examine the effect on whole body energy expenditure | — |
| Evaluate the effects on fasting and postprandial glucose excursions | — |
| Evaluate the effects on hemoglobin A1c (HbA1c) | — |
Secondary
| Measure | Time frame |
|---|---|
| Assess the effects of ISIS 113715 on rates of basal and insulin stimulated whole body glycerol turnover | — |
| Assess the effects of ISIS 113715 on insulin suppression of local rates of lipolysis (microdialysis) | — |
| Expand the safety and tolerability profile for ISIS 113715 | — |
